What is the Significance of "Even Cowgirls Get the Blues"?
The phrase itself, "Even Cowgirls Get the Blues," is more than just a catchy title. It subtly subverts expectations. The image of a cowgirl, often associated with strength and independence, is juxtaposed with the universal emotion of sadness, hinting at the complexities of the human experience. Tom Robbins's novel, published in 1976, is known for its surreal humor, feminist themes, and exploration of unconventional lifestyles, all of which contribute to the enduring appeal of the phrase and, consequently, the sweatshirt that bears it. It's a statement of embracing the full spectrum of human emotion, even for those who might appear outwardly tough or resilient.
